Field Observation Analysis

  Majority of people used credit cards vs. cash

  Some people automatically paid using card   Small pouch for only cards

  Cash only places: Some people came in and left due to lack of cash

Experiment Analysis

  Girls manage money better

  Unfortunate events; sickness

  Packing own lunch is a good strategy

  Different lifestyles; some eat more than others, stress and emotional factors

  Socializing with friends mostly translates to eating out; should find alternative ways to gather with friends

Conclusion

  People are too dependant on credit/debit cards

  Girls were more successful in the challenge because they planned beforehand and had a strategy going into the challenge

  Even though people claim that they want to see their money physically exchanged, they prefer to use credit cards for convenience

  Guys prefer not to plan as it is too complicated and time consuming
